    Web design is an ever-evolving field that reflects advancements in technology, changing user expectations, and cultural trends. As we head into 2025, new trends are emerging that will shape how we create engaging, user-friendly, and visually stunning websites. Here, we’ll delve into the top web design trends and best practices for the year ahead, where we explore what makes them significant, their key characteristics and how Elementor can help you bring them to life.

    Micro-Interactions

    Micro-interactions are those subtle yet impactful animations or responses to user actions that breathe life into a website and enhance engagement. Think of buttons transforming when hovered over, tooltips appearing on colorful links, or visuals that gently fade into view. These elements add personality and interactivity to your site while ensuring the user experience feels intuitive and human.

    This trend reflects our desire for instant feedback and gratification in a digital world. When users see a relevant response to their actions—whether it’s submitting a form or navigating a menu—it creates a sense of acknowledgment and enjoyment.

    How to Use Elementor for Micro-Interactions: With Elementor, you can easily incorporate micro-interactions:

    • Add Entrance Animations and Motion Effects to elements.
    • Utilize Hover Effects and Styling Transformations to make widgets interactive.
    • Integrate Lottie Animations and Animated Headlines for playful, responsive designs.
    • Employ the Hotspot Widget to create interactive tooltips.

    Retro Style

    Retro style will always remain on the list of design trends, but what is considered retro evolves over time. As we move further away from the early digital eras, each decade’s unique visual language redefines what feels nostalgic and iconic.

    Retro style usually reflects the soul of a one particular era with bold colors, pixel art, glitch effects, and neon accents paired with handcrafted elements like illustrations and handwritten fonts.  When these visuals are blended with modern web capabilities, we can achieve a great visual experience. 

    Retro style websites and visuals tap into the collective longing for the aesthetics and vibes of 80’s, 90’s, and early 2000’s. It’s also a reaction to overly polished designs, offering something raw, playful, and relatable.

    How to Use Elementor for Retro Style:

    • Experiment with Custom Typography Controls for bold and quirky fonts where you can use variable fonts that allow you to play with their width and weight.
    • Apply Background Overlays and Gradients to craft retro-inspired palettes.
    • Use CSS Filters to create glitch effects or vintage vibes.

    Interactive 3D Elements

    Interactive 3D elements add depth and realism, transforming websites into immersive experiences. Whether it’s a product preview on an e-commerce site or dynamic storytelling on a landing page, 3D designs captivate users and keep them engaged.

    This trend is driven by advancements in technology and the popularity of AR/VR-like experiences, where digital products blend into our daily lives more naturally and consumers’ affinity  for hyper-realistic digital experiences. Tools like no-code platforms and AI integrations make 3D creation more accessible to web designers than ever before.

    How to Use Elementor for 3D Elements:

    • Leverage the Elementor AI Image Generator to create 3D visuals and animations.
    • Enhance these elements with Mouse Effects, 3D Tilt  and Transform Tools for added realism.

    Delimann Hampers is a Devon based family business specialising in gift hampers full of delicious food and drink.  We offer a wide range of Devon cream teas, afternoon cream teas with cakes and biscuits, gluten free hampers, cheese & savoury hampers, wine & prosecco hampers and chocolate gifts. All our hampers are hand-packed with your personal message on one of our designed occasion cards and come with FREE UK delivery.

    Don’t forget to take a look at our occasion ranges including Birthday Hampers, Thank You Gifts, Congratulations Hampers, Get Well Soon gifts and seasonal collections for Christmas, Mother’s & Father’s Day and Easter.

    We’ve created our hampers and gifts to be an overall foodie experience that can be enjoyed by everyone. We take great care and pride in designing our bespoke hamper ranges so that they make truly delicious and thoughtful gifts for any occasion.

    By developing our own bakes with local producers, as well as working with specialist independents & artisans across the country, we have selected the best produce to include in our hamper and gifts.

    Our Afternoon Tea and Cream Tea hampers, delivered straight to the door on your chosen delivery date, continues to be a much talked about gift across the UK, with over 5000 5 star reviews.  Our scones are freshly baked by our local baker on the day of dispatch so that they can be enjoyed as fresh as possible the next day along with our award winning Delimann Strawberry Jam

    We’ve steadily expanded our range of hampers as we discover new and exiting produce. Along with our award winning cream teas, take a look at our delicious cheese & savoury selection, gluten free hampers, chocolate & sweet treats along with fine wines and local ales & cider gifts.

    Ⅰ 私たちの「クリエイティブ集団COW AND CATの「出版サポート」の特徴

    Amazonの出版サービスを利用して自分の費用で本を出版するの話です。あなたは作業が多いのに驚くでしょう。私たちはそんなAmazon自費出版の難しいこと・専門的なことを格安代行します。それが「出版サポート」です。

    このページでは個々のサポートの費用をご提案する予定です。しかしその前にもう1度「出版サポート」の特徴を簡単にご紹介しておこうと思います。

    1. Amazonの自費出版サービスを利用して紙書籍、電子書籍を作成します。
    2. 作成した書籍はAmazonのサイトで販売します。
    3. 定価の10%の印税をお支払いします。
    4. 自分で取り組むにはハードルが高い。他の自費出版社では対応していない。そのような「企画化」「構成」のサポートを行います。
      「企画化」とはあなたの主張、物語をマーケティング的最適な形にすることです。具体的にに最も読者に受け入れられる内容。切り口。テイストを決めることです。さらにそれ以前のあなたが漠然と考えている内容を「言語化」することも含みます。
      「構成」とは「言語化」したものを分かりやすい。面白い。感動する。役に立つ。という最適な順番に並べることです。
    5. 「企画化」「構成」以前のご相談は何回でも無料でご対応します。「こういうアイデアを持っているが、どう本にしたらいいのか」というようことです。(メールまたはオンラインミーティングを利用します)
    6. 本を作るために非常にたくさんある作業のうち、あなたが苦手な部分を代行します。
    7. 代行する内容は「メニュー化」されており、あなたはその中から選ぶだけです。
    8. 「メニュー」化した作業には明確に料金が示されています。あなたは予算内で何を依頼するか、が簡単に検討できます。
    9. 結果的に「何にいくらかかるので、費用はいくらになる」と言うことが明確になります。ダマされることは絶対にありません。
    10. 出版後の販売促進もオプションで対応します。

    このように私たちは明瞭会計で、あなたのご要望に寄り添ったサポートを行います。そしてあなたの理想とする(あるいはそれ以上の本を)出版します。できると言うことが「出版サポート」です。

    ではAmazonの自費出版をする上でのサポートの料金を一覧でご紹介します。

    1. 基本手数料(Amazonへの入稿費用、表紙作成費用、ISBN付与) 5万円
    2. 簡易校正(誤字脱字、主述の不一致、「てにをは」の間違いの校正):Amazon用の原稿に仕上げた時に1ページ✕150円
    3. 校訂(日本語としての意味不明・誤用の修正、文章および文意レベル、 論理構成レベルでの修正、著者様の意図が伝わる文章へのブラッシュアップ):Amazon用の原稿に仕上げた時に1ページ当たり1ページ✕500円
    4. Amazon印刷用の原稿の仕様への変換(章扉作成、章タイトルの装飾、目次作成、見出しの設定と装飾を含む):Amazon用の原稿に仕上げた時に1ページ当たり1ページ✕150円
    5. 原稿の代筆(校正、校訂、Amazon仕様原稿への変換は含みません):400字詰め原稿用紙1枚×3,000円
    6. すでに内容が言語化しているものの「企画化」「構成」する:基本手数料+5万円=10万円
    7. 頭の中に漠然とある内容を言語化した上で「企画化」「構成」する:基本手数料+10万円=15万円 
    8. 取材費(内容を作成するための取材、インタビューン度が発生する時):別途、内容、分量に沿ってお見積りします
